﻿@charset "utf-8";
/*******二级-政府机构-主体******/
.zfjg_maincon{border:#cfcfcf 1px solid;margin-bottom:30px;    padding: 10px 20px;}
.zfjg_maincon .title{line-height:40px;padding:25px 0;font-size:33px;font-weight:bold;color:#b80608;}
.zfjg_lmtit{height:42px;line-height:42px;background:#f9f9f9 url("../images/home/line_e4.gif") 0 bottom repeat-x;overflow:hidden;}
.zfjg_lmtit span,.zfjg_lmtit a{display:block;width:180px;height:42px;text-align:center;font-size:21px;color:#fff;background:#b80608;}
.zfjg_lmtit a:hover{color:#fff;cursor:default;}
.zfjg_lmtit a.link:hover{cursor:pointer;}
.zfjg_lmcon{padding:15px 0;}
.zfjg_lmcon ul{width:110%;}
.zfjg_lmcon ul li{float:left;    width: 386px;padding: 0 50px 0 26px;font-size:16px;background:url(../images/home/ico_cf5.gif) 13px center no-repeat;}
.zfjg_lmcon li a,.zfjg_lmcon li span{display:block;height:40px;line-height:40px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;}
.zfjg_lmcon li a:hover{color: #b80608;}
/*.zfjg_lmcon li a{cursor:default !important;}*/
.zfjg_lmcon2 ul li{width: 185px;padding:0 88px 0 26px; }
@media only screen and (max-width:1199px) {
	.zfjg_lmcon ul li{width:174px;padding:0 30px 0 26px;}
	.zfjg_lmcon2 ul li{width: 184px;padding:0 20px 0 26px;}
}
@media only screen and (max-width:991px ) {
	.zfjg_maincon{margin:0 15px 15px;padding:10px 25px;}
	.zfjg_maincon .title{padding:15px 0;font-size:28px;}
	.zfjg_lmtit span,.zfjg_lmtit a{font-size:20px;}
	.zfjg_lmcon{padding:10px 0;}
	.zfjg_lmcon ul li{width:176px;padding:0 30px 0 26px;}
	
	.bgcolor{padding:20px 0 !important;}
}
@media only screen and (max-width:767px ) {
	.zfjg_maincon{margin:0 10px 10px;padding:10px 10px;}
	.zfjg_maincon .title{padding:5px 0 10px;font-size:24px;}
	.zfjg_lmtit span,.zfjg_lmtit a{width:160px;font-size:18px;}
	.zfjg_lmcon ul{width:100%;}
	.zfjg_lmcon ul li{width:52%;padding:0 2% 0 16px;background-position:3px center;box-sizing:border-box;}
	.zfjg_lmcon ul li:nth-of-type(2n){width:48%;padding-right:0;}
	.zfjg_lmcon li a,.zfjg_lmcon li span{height:36px;line-height:36px;}
}

.m-banner-jgzn img{max-width:100%;margin:0 auto 20px;display:block;}
.jgzn_table{margin-top:20px; border: 1px #ccc solid;}
.jgzn_table th{ background: #f8f8f8; font-size: 16px; height: 40px; border-left: 2px #fff solid; width: 160px;text-align: center;}
.jgzn_table th.t1{border-left: 0; width: auto;}
.jgzn_table td{ padding:5px 5px; border-left: 2px #f8f8f8 solid; border-bottom: 2px #f8f8f8 solid; font-size: 15px; line-height: 20px; color: #999;text-align: center;}
.jgzn_table td.t1{border-left: 0 none;}

.u-tit-list{height:40px;line-height:40px;background:#f5f5f5;}
.u-tit-list span{display:inline-block;width:120px;height:40px;line-height:40px;background:#0863c0;text-align:center;font-size:18px;color:#f5f5f5;font-weight:bold;}